It must be under 100 lines of code. It should be well-commented and easy to understand. It should provide something interesting—this could be a unique algorithm, a cool use case, or a clever trick in Python. Name your file using a descriptive title of what the code does.

One more importing thing add your python or ipynb file in a new folder and ask for the pull request.
